用户现在的问题是关于使用大模型(如 Transformer)来下棋,比如围棋、国际象棋等,认为这是用人类思维去做机器应该做的事,反而暴露了人类的缺点。用户提到之前讨论的 Coq、Isabelle 等简洁理性模型是否更适合这类任务,并且想了解这些模型的更多情况。
首先,我需要回顾之前的对话历史。用户之前的问题集中在大模型的统计特性、数学工具的应用,以及是否存在更简洁的理性模型。现在用户看到大模型用于棋类游戏,认为这可能不是最优解,转而询问更适合的形式化模型。
接下来,我需要分析用户的具体需求。用户希望了解 Coq、Isabelle 等模型的情况,特别是它们在棋类游戏中的适用性,以及训练成本和规模。用户可能认为这些形式化工具更高效、更理性,适合解决需要精确逻辑推理的任务。
然后,我需要确定如何回答。首先,需要解释 Coq 和 Isabelle 的基本概念和应用领域,说明它们与棋类游戏的关系。其次,要比较大模型和形式化工具在棋类任务中的优缺点,比如搜索效率、确定性、训练成本等。最后,可能需要提到其他相关的形式化方法或算法,如 AlphaZero,以全面回答用户的问题。
在思考过程中,需要注意用户可能对形式化方法不太熟悉,因此需要用简单易懂的语言解释,避免过于专业的术语。同时,用户可能关心实际应用案例,所以需要举一些例子,比如定理证明、棋类游戏中的具体应用。
另外,用户提到训练成本和规模,这可能涉及到计算资源的使用。需要说明形式化工具通常不需要大量数据和计算资源,而是依赖于规则和逻辑,因此训练成本较低,模型规模小。
还需要考虑用户可能的深层需求,即寻找更高效、更理性的 AI 模型,而不仅仅是依赖统计方法的大模型。因此,回答中需要强调形式化方法的优势,如确定性、可解释性,以及在特定领域的高效性。
最后,需要确保回答结构清晰,分点说明,并且涵盖用户提到的所有方面,包括模型介绍、应用场景、优缺点比较等。
现在需要分析用户的问题,即为什么大模型被用来下棋,而像 Coq、Isabelle 这样的形式化工具似乎更适合,同时想了解这些模型的情况。根据已有的搜索结果,我需要进一步整理和补充信息。
首先,用户提到的 Coq 和 Isabelle 属于交互式定理证明器,主要用于形式化验证和数学证明。它们的优势在于精确性和可解释性,但在棋类游戏中的应用可能有限。搜索结果显示,AlphaZero 和 AlphaProof 等系统结合了强化学习和形式化方法,成功解决了数学问题和棋类任务。例如,AlphaZero 通过自我对弈和蒙特卡洛树搜索(MCTS)在围棋、国际象棋等游戏中表现出色,而 AlphaProof 则结合了 Gemini 大模型和 AlphaZero 算法,在 IMO 竞赛中取得银牌。
另外,豆包的 BFS-Prover 采用 BFS 算法和专家迭代,在形式化数学证明中取得了突破,显示了简洁模型的潜力。而书生・思客则结合了大模型和透明思维链,在围棋中实现了可解释性。这些信息表明,形式化工具和大模型在不同场景下各有优势,形式化方法在确定性任务中更高效,而大模型在处理复杂、模糊的问题时更灵活。
然而,用户可能关心的训练成本和规模方面,搜索结果提到 Coq 和 Isabelle 不需要大量数据,训练成本低,但需要专业知识进行编码。而大模型如 AlphaZero 需要大量计算资源,但通过自我对弈生成数据。此外,BFS-Prover 的训练成本较低,且模型规模小,适合特定任务。
不过,关于 Coq 和 Isabelle 在棋类游戏中的具体应用案例,搜索结果中并未直接提及,可能需要进一步搜索。此外,用户可能想知道这些形式化工具如何具体应用于棋类,是否有实际案例或研究。例如,是否有使用 Coq 或 Isabelle 来构建棋类 AI 的研究,或者它们在棋类规则验证中的应用。
另外,用户提到的 “训练成本” 可能包括时间、计算资源和人力成本。搜索结果中提到形式化工具如 Coq 和 Isabelle 需要专家进行编码,这可能增加人力成本,而大模型虽然计算资源需求高,但自动化程度高。需要更详细的对比数据来支持这一点。
总结来看,已有的搜索结果提供了形式化工具在数学证明和棋类中的部分应用,但关于 Coq 和 Isabelle 在棋类游戏中的具体应用案例、训练成本的详细对比,以及它们与大模型在棋类任务中的优缺点比较,仍有不足。因此,需要进一步搜索相关关键词,如 “Coq 棋类游戏应用”、“Isabelle 棋类案例” 等,以获取更直接的信息,确保回答的准确性和全面性。
现在需要继续分析用户的问题,结合新的搜索结果来判断是否需要进一步搜索。用户主要关注的是 Coq 和 Isabelle 等形式化工具在棋类游戏中的应用,以及它们的训练成本和规模。
首先,根据新搜索结果,摘要 11 提到 Coq 和 Isabelle 属于交互式定理证明器,主要用于形式化验证和数学证明,而棋类游戏被归类为形式化任务,因为其目标可以精确描述。摘要 14 指出,形式化任务(如围棋)的目标明确,适合 AI 处理,但过程复杂。这说明形式化工具理论上可以应用于棋类,但具体案例仍不明确。
摘要 9 和 10 讨论了 AI 在游戏中的应用,但未直接涉及 Coq 或 Isabelle。摘要 12 提到 7B 参数的小模型在形式化推理中的突破,显示形式化方法可能在特定任务中高效。摘要 11 中的工具链实践指南提到 Coq 在定理证明中的应用,但未涉及棋类。
关于训练成本,摘要 12 提到小模型部署成本低,而摘要 11 提到 Coq 需要专家编码,可能增加人力成本。但具体对比 Coq/Isabelle 与大模型在棋类中的训练成本仍缺乏数据。
目前,仍缺乏 Coq 和 Isabelle 在棋类游戏中的具体应用案例,例如是否有研究使用它们构建棋类 AI 或验证棋类规则。此外,训练成本的详细对比(如时间、计算资源、人力)也未明确。因此,需要进一步搜索 “Coq 棋类 AI”、“Isabelle 棋类规则验证” 等关键词,以获取直接案例和对比数据,确保回答的准确性和全面性。
现在需要综合所有搜索结果来回答用户的问题。用户主要关心 Coq 和 Isabelle 等形式化工具在棋类游戏中的应用,以及它们的训练成本和规模。
首先,根据之前的搜索结果,Coq 和 Isabelle 属于交互式定理证明器,主要用于形式化验证和数学证明。它们的优势在于精确性和可解释性,但在棋类游戏中的应用案例较少。搜索结果中提到的 AlphaZero 和 AlphaProof 等系统结合了强化学习和形式化方法,成功解决了数学问题和棋类任务,但并未直接使用 Coq 或 Isabelle。
新搜索结果显示,棋类游戏被归类为形式化任务,因为其目标可以精确描述。例如,摘要 14 指出围棋的目标明确,适合 AI 处理,但过程复杂。然而,Coq 和 Isabelle 在棋类中的具体应用案例仍不明确。摘要 15 和 19 讨论了棋类 AI 的实现,但使用的是传统算法(如蒙特卡洛树搜索)或机器学习方法,而非形式化工具。
关于训练成本,摘要 12 提到小模型(如 7B 参数)在形式化推理中的突破,显示形式化方法可能在特定任务中高效。摘要 11 提到 Coq 需要专家编码,可能增加人力成本,而大模型虽然计算资源需求高,但自动化程度高。然而,具体对比 Coq/Isabelle 与大模型在棋类中的训练成本仍缺乏数据。
此外,用户可能想知道形式化工具如何具体应用于棋类,例如验证棋类规则或构建 AI。搜索结果中未找到直接案例,但摘要 11 提到形式化工具在硬件验证和安全协议中的应用,间接说明其在规则明确的任务中的潜力。
总结来看,虽然形式化工具理论上适合棋类任务,但实际应用案例有限,且训练成本的对比数据不足。因此,进一步搜索 “Coq 棋类规则验证” 或 “Isabelle 棋类 AI” 可能提供更直接的信息,但考虑到已有信息已能说明形式化工具的优势和局限性,继续搜索可能无法显著增加回答的深度。因此,可以停止搜索,基于现有信息进行回答。